Fat-specific Protein 27 Regulates Storage of Triacylglycerol

Abstract: FSP27 (fat-specific protein 27) is a member of the cell deathinducing DNA fragmentation factor-␣-like effector (CIDE) family. Although Cidea and Cideb were initially characterized as activators of apoptosis, recent studies have demonstrated important metabolic roles for these proteins. In this study, we investigated the function of another member of this family, FSP27 (Cidec), in apoptosis and adipocyte metabolism. “…In liver, loss of ROR␣ affected the expression of many genes that regulate lipid homeostasis. The cell death-inducing DFFA-like effector c (Cidec), also termed fat-specific protein (FSP27), and cell death-inducing DFFA-like effector a (Cidea), two proteins that play a critical role in triglyceride accumulation (26,39,62), and monoacylglycerol O-acyltransferase 1 (Mogat1), which is part of an alternative pathway of triglyceride synthesis, were among the genes most strongly suppressed in ROR␣ sg/sg liver. The expression of several other genes implicated in fatty acid homeostasis was also repressed in ROR␣ sg/sg liver.…”

“…Moreover, in addition to being lipid droplet-localized proteins per se, ectopic expression of FSP27 and CIDEA has been demonstrated to promote the formation and/or enlargement of lipid droplets in several nonadipocyte cell types, a phenomenon that is particularly evident with addition of exogenous oleic acid to culture media. This has been shown for FLAG-tagged FSP27 in 3T3-L1 preadipocytes (12) and for eGFP-FSP27 in 3T3-L1 preadipocytes, 293T, and COS cells (12,25). For CIDEA, FLAG-tagged CIDEA has been demonstrated to promote lipid droplet formation in 3T3-L1 preadipocytes (12).…”
